이쁜왕자 만쉐~~
C 언어 printf format 문제 본문
다음과 같은 조건을 만족하는 printf format 을 만드시오.
1. 출력하고자 하는 데이터는 string 이다.
2. string 이 10자 보다 길면, 앞에서 10자까지 짜른다.
3. string 이 10자 보다 짧으면, 오른쪽에 공백을 채워 10자를 만든다.
4. 별다른 string 연산 없이 printf format 만으로 해결하라.
입력 "abcde"
출력 [abcde_____] (괄호는 공백를 표현하기 위함, 언더바는 공백)
입력 "abcdefghijklmn"
출력 [abcdefghij]
이거 정답은 찾긴 찾았는데, 이런식으로 printf 포맷팅을 해보긴 처음이군요. 한번 맞춰 보세요.
- 이쁜왕자 -
- Valken the SEXy THief~~ ^_* -
728x90
반응형
Comments